Signs of Parasite Infestations



To identify a bug infestation, you need to be able to recognize the indications.

One of the most usual indicators of a parasite invasion is the presence of droppings. Whether it's small mouse droppings or bigger roach droppings, finding these waste matters is a clear indicator that pests have made themselves at home.

Another indicator to look out for is chewed or damaged materials. Pests like rats and termites commonly chomp on furnishings, wall surfaces, and cords, leaving behind visible damage.

Additionally, if you see uncommon sounds such as scraping, hurrying, or humming, it could be an indication of parasites concealing in your wall surfaces or attic room.

Finally, watch for any type of foul odors. Parasites like rats and roaches discharge a distinct odor that can be conveniently detected.

Reliable Pest Therapy Approaches



If you've identified indicators of a bug invasion in your home, it's important to take immediate action and carry out effective insect therapy methods.

The initial step is to determine the type of parasite you're dealing with. If it's ants or cockroaches, lures and sprays can be effective in eliminating them.

For bed insects, an expert pest control specialist is often required, as they're challenging to remove by yourself.

When managing rodents, catches and sealants are typically utilized to remove them and stop future entry. It is necessary to follow the guidelines meticulously when making use of chemicals or catches to make sure safety and security for both human beings and pet dogs.



Furthermore, preserving cleanliness and appropriate sanitation in your house can help prevent future infestations.

Proactive Bug Prevention Techniques



Take positive steps to prevent bug problems in your home by applying effective methods. By being aggressive, you can conserve yourself the problem and potential damage caused by parasites.

Here are three vital methods to help you avoid bug problems:

2. Seal off entry points: Evaluate your home for any kind of cracks, gaps, or openings that pests can make use of to go into. Seal these access factors with caulk or weatherstripping to stop insects from gaining access to your home.

3. Remove standing water: Pests like mosquitoes and rodents are drawn in to standing water. Regularly evaluate your building for any kind of locations where water may accumulate, such as stopped up seamless gutters or flower pots, and get rid of these resources to dissuade insects from breeding.
